jtharvie Posted July 25, 2006 Share #1 Posted July 25, 2006 Advertisement (gone after registration) These are escapees from a Hutterite farm about 80 kilometers down river from Winnipeg. They have been traveling down the Assisnboine river and came to a dead stop when they reached what is know as "The Forks" where the Assiniboine River meets the Red River. This area is a National Park and tourist area. Normally the boat operator sells seeds and grain for the wild ducks but these Peking Ducks have been getting all the attention. The local naturalist was on the radio today saying that he doubts these ducks will leave and if rounded up they will make there way back in very short order..
